1. Understanding Smile Makeovers

Before delving into the science behind smile makeovers, it is essential to understand what they are. A smile makeover is the process of improving the appearance of your teeth and overall smile through various cosmetic dentistry procedures. These procedures can include teeth whitening, dental veneers, dental implants, and orthodontic treatments, among others. The goal is to create a harmonious and aesthetically pleasing smile that fits your unique facial features.

Smile makeovers are not just about cosmetic improvements; they also address the functionality and health of your teeth. By correcting bite issues, misalignments, and other dental concerns, smile makeovers can improve your oral health and enhance your ability to chew and speak properly.

2. The Role of Digital Imaging and Analysis

Achieving a perfect smile requires careful planning and precise execution. This is where digital imaging and analysis play a crucial role. Dentists use 3D digital scanning and imaging technologies to assess your current smile, identify areas that require improvement, and create a customized treatment plan.

These advanced imaging techniques allow dentists to simulate the desired outcomes of various procedures, giving you a preview of how your new smile will look before any work begins. This technology also helps dentists communicate better with their patients, as they can easily explain the recommended procedures and expected results in a visual and easily understandable manner.

3. Teeth Whitening: Brightening Smiles, Boosting Confidence

Yellow or stained teeth can be a significant source of self-consciousness and can impact your self-esteem. Teeth whitening is a common procedure in smile makeovers that aims to restore the natural brightness of your teeth. It involves removing stains and discoloration using various methods such as in-office bleaching, at-home whitening kits, or a combination of both.

Professional teeth whitening treatments are considered safe and effective, providing dramatic results in just a few sessions. With a brighter smile, you can feel more confident and willing to share your happiness with the world.

4. Dental Veneers: A Flawless Smile Transformation

Dental veneers are ultra-thin, custom-made shells that are bonded to the front surface of your teeth to improve their appearance. They can completely transform the shape, color, and size of your teeth, giving you a flawless and natural-looking smile.

Made from high-quality materials like porcelain or composite resin, dental veneers are durable and stain-resistant. They can be individually crafted to match the color of your surrounding teeth, ensuring a seamless and harmonious smile makeover.

In addition to their aesthetic benefits, dental veneers can also correct minor teeth misalignments and address issues like gaps between teeth, providing a simple and efficient solution to multiple dental concerns.

5. Dental Implants: The Perfect Smile Foundation

If you have missing teeth, dental implants can be an integral part of your smile makeover. Dental implants are metal posts that are surgically inserted into the jawbone, acting as artificial tooth roots. They provide a stable foundation for dental crowns or bridges, restoring the functionality and aesthetics of your smile.

Unlike other tooth replacement options, dental implants offer a long-term solution that mimics the natural look and feel of your teeth. With proper care, dental implants can last a lifetime, making them a worthwhile investment in your smile and oral health.

6. Orthodontic Treatments: Aligning Teeth, Perfecting Smiles

Orthodontic treatments are often a crucial component of smile makeovers, especially for individuals with crooked or misaligned teeth. Traditional braces, clear aligners, and other orthodontic appliances can help straighten your teeth, correct bite issues, and create a harmonious smile.

Advancements in orthodontic treatments, such as Invisalign, have made teeth straightening more discreet and convenient than ever before. These clear aligners gradually shift your teeth into the desired position, allowing you to achieve a beautiful smile without the hassle of traditional metal braces.

7. Enhancing Your Smile with Gum Contouring

While most focus on teeth, the appearance of your gums also plays a significant role in the overall aesthetics of your smile. Excessive gum tissue or an uneven gum line can make your teeth appear shorter or uneven. Gum contouring, also known as gum reshaping, is a cosmetic dental procedure that involves removing excess gum tissue or reshaping the gum line to enhance the proportion and symmetry of your smile.

Using laser technology, dentists can precisely sculpt the gums, ensuring a painless and quick procedure with minimal recovery time. Gum contouring can make a substantial difference in your smile, giving you a more balanced and harmonious appearance.

Frequently Asked Questions (FAQs)

Q: How long do smile makeovers usually take?

A: The duration of a smile makeover can vary depending on the complexity of the procedures involved and the individual's dental condition. In some cases, a complete smile makeover may take several months to achieve the desired results.

Q: Will smile makeovers be covered by dental insurance?

A: Cosmetic procedures, including smile makeovers, are often not covered by dental insurance as they are considered elective. However, it is recommended to check with your dental insurance provider as coverage may vary.

Q: Are smile makeovers painful?

A: Smile makeovers are typically performed under local anesthesia, ensuring a pain-free experience during the procedures. Discomfort and mild soreness may be experienced after the treatment, but it is usually temporary and can be managed with over-the-counter pain relievers.

Q: How long do the results of a smile makeover last?

A: The longevity of your smile makeover results depends on various factors, including proper oral hygiene, regular dental check-ups, and lifestyle habits such as smoking and consuming staining substances. With good care, the results can last for many years.

Q: Am I a suitable candidate for a smile makeover?

A: Virtually anyone with dental imperfections or dissatisfaction with their smile can be a candidate for a smile makeover. However, it is best to consult with a qualified cosmetic dentist who can assess your specific dental conditions and recommend the most suitable treatments for you.
